A2 - PB - Y1 - 2020 LA - eng AB - The transverse momentum (P-T) spectra of inclusively produced A c P baryons are measured via the exclusive decay channel Lambda(+)(c) -> pK(-)pi(+) using the CMS detector at the LHC. Spectra are measured as a function of transverse momentum in proton-proton (pp) and lead-lead (PbPb) collisions at a nucleonnucleon center-of-mass energy of 5.02TeV.
